Duke of Wellington is a cozy and inviting 19th century pub tucked away behind Sloane Square and the Kings Road. Victoria coach and rail stations are just a stones throw away.
It was built originally as a reading room – popular among 19th century residents who went there to read the morning newspapers - but many locals said they’d rather have liquid refreshment than reading matter and they won the day!
